Over the past years, her exploration of themes such as human figures & coffee as an expression of self love, sunflower as an expression of hope & vibrant colors as an expression of positivity and joy has been a continuous driving force in her creative process.
Her art embodies a sense of joy and positivity that reflects her passion for helping people “cope” and find joy in life’s mundane things - because life is short yet beautiful.
For her, to create art is to make herself and people feel again. Why?
She usually says "People often take for granted the simple objects or gestures they experience in life - but these things are what makes them feel, or what makes them alive. So I want to emphasize them through my art to remind people of them (these things)."
Her creative practice includes an array of mediums such as digital art, traditional painting, and digital art installations.
